Background Information
In the last 24-72 hours, a troubling trend has emerged. It seems to have started around February 9-10, 2025. Thousands of businesses worldwide have noticed a sudden drop in their Google Business reviews. Some have lost dozens or even hundreds of reviews overnight. Local search experts started speculating. They thought it may be linked to Google tightening its review policies, possibly removing reviews that don’t meet their guidelines. This situation has sparked concern among business owners who rely heavily on customer feedback to build trust and credibility in their communities.
Key Details of the News
- Timing: The review disappearance issue began within the last few days and has escalated quickly, catching many businesses off guard.
- Scale: This is not specific to the US. Countless businesses around the globe are affected, with reports of some losing a significant number of reviews in a very short time.
- Possible Causes: Initial expectations were that Google may be enforcing stricter compliance with its review policies, leading to the removal of certain reviews.
- Community Reaction: Business owners have taken to various platforms, including Google Business Profile forums and social media, to express their frustration and seek answers about the situation.
Google’s Official Comments
Google has acknowledged the glitch on its forums, clarifying that the reviews are not permanently lost and that they are actively working on a fix.

Impact and Implications
The immediate impact of this issue on business owners is somewhat significant, as lost reviews can affect their visibility and reputation online. However, if all businesses lose a similar percentage, one would expect it would not result in a loss of actual business. On the other hand, if some businesses are losing more than others, that could be a serious cause for concern. For example, imagine a small local restaurant in Greenville, SC, that relies on positive reviews to draw in new diners. If they suddenly see their review count drop, potential customers might think twice before choosing them over competitors.
